Last night after the incident, He Xinyao sent a message to Zheng Zhouzhou, but until the next morning, He Xinyao didn’t receive a reply from Zheng Zhouzhou.

Of course, He Xinyao wouldn’t think that Zheng Zhouzhou was deliberately not replying to her. She thought that maybe Zhouzhou went to bed very early.

In fact, even if Zheng Zhouzhou replied to her, He Xinyao didn’t know what to say. She messed things up, and Zhouzhou would definitely think she was useless.

She never anticipated this. He Xinyao couldn’t understand. She wondered when Jiang Jiang had taken the recording pen—perhaps when I had grabbed her so suddenly?

It was possible. After all, the light around the long chair was relatively dim, and the situation had been tense. Xie Xiao could have made small movements without me noticing.

He Xinyao touched the bandage on her face, a flicker of fear crossing her expression.

The doctor said that if the wound on her face was deeper, it was likely to leave a scar.

Thinking of the girl covered in blood mentioned by Xie Xiao, He Xinyao couldn’t help but shudder. She had nightmares all night last night, and the dream was full of the appearance of that person falling from the roof.

Reason told He Xinyao that many people knew about that incident back then, and Xie Xiao was likely deliberately scaring her, but Xie Xiao was too evil, and He Xinyao couldn’t help but think about the girl. Could it be that she really saw something?

Otherwise, how could she explain that there was no one behind her at that time, but there was a bruise on her calf after being hit?

What exactly kicked me?

He Xinyao couldn’t help but find her phone again and sent all her guesses to Zheng Zhouzhou.

[Yao Yao Who Loves To Drink Porridge: Zhouzhou, you must be careful, what if Xie Xiao also uses evil magic to deal with you, this kind of dirty means is really hard to guard against.]

Zheng Zhouzhou still didn’t reply to her.

He Xinyao was full of worry, only hoping that Zheng Zhouzhou could see her message sooner.

But in fact, Zheng Zhouzhou had already seen it.

She irritably put down her phone and clicked into the chat box with Ji Heyuan again. The last message was still the sentence “Okay” she sent, and Ji Heyuan never replied to her again.

Zheng Zhouzhou knew that Ji Heyuan was angry. She should coax Ji Heyuan at this time, but there were too many annoying things recently. Zheng Zhouzhou felt uneasy in her heart, as if something had lost control.

It seemed that ever since Liang Junsheng’s scandal broke, she was suppressed by Xie Xiao, making it impossible to get close to the Ji family.

Zheng Zhouzhou was originally glad that she hadn’t offended Xie Xiao too badly. Ji Xu’an probably wouldn’t bother with her. Even without the Ji family’s support, Zheng Zhouzhou could still leverage her knowledge to find other opportunities.

But she wondered if she was simply unlucky, or if someone was deliberately sabotaging her. Zheng Zhouzhou felt incredibly unlucky.

First was Chen Tang. Zheng Zhouzhou had seen the news in her previous life, and this time she deliberately arrived at the hot pot restaurant one step earlier to save her.

Originally, Chen Tang was very grateful to her, and promised her that she would introduce her to try out for a play by a well-known director.

Zheng Zhouzhou had been looking forward to it, but after they separated that day, there was no follow-up to this matter.

She went to ask Chen Tang, but the other party’s attitude was a bit strange, and she also tested her implicitly, seeming to suspect that there was another hidden story behind this matter.

Zheng Zhouzhou was furious, but couldn’t explain her sudden appearance at the hot pot restaurant. She stubbornly refused to admit to anything. Chen Tang had no proof linking her to the incident.

However, this blocked her path to getting close to Chen Tang.

Zheng Zhouzhou couldn’t expose this matter yet. She was just a small star with no name, but Chen Tang was a very famous producer in the circle. The other party had too many connections than her, and could easily block her.

Zheng Zhouzhou didn’t dare to offend Chen Tang at all.

Looking back at everything since her rebirth, Zheng Zhouzhou suddenly felt a little lost.

At the beginning of her rebirth, Zheng Zhouzhou was full of spirit and eager to change her life. She also did a good job, and won Ji Heyuan’s heart from the beginning.

At that time, although Ji Xu’an didn’t like her very much, she didn’t put her mind on such a little person like Zheng Zhouzhou.

As long as she was patient enough, Ji Heyuan would really fall in love with her sooner or later. If Ji Heyuan sincerely wanted to be with her, what could Ji Xu’an do even if she disagreed?

Even if Ji Heyuan was just a second daughter who usually stayed out of things, she had the backing of the Linghai Group. If she were willing to humble herself and plead with Ji Xu’an on Zheng Zhouzhou’s behalf, wouldn’t Ji Xu’an surely provide resources?

My plans were clearly very good, when did they start to deviate?

It started from the time Xie Xiao appeared.

In her memories, Xie Xiao had been a naive simpleton, but after several encounters, Zheng Zhouzhou had suffered greatly at Xie Xiao’s hands. Now, looking at He Xinyao’s message, a long-forgotten suspicion resurfaced in Zheng Zhouzhou’s mind.

Was the current Xie Xiao really the Xie Xiao in my memory?

…

In the morning, Ji Xu’an still sent Jiang Jiang and Ji Heyuan to school.

Jiang Jiang sensed something odd in Ji Heyuan’s gaze. It lacked last night’s enthusiasm, yet wasn’t distant either; instead, it held a strange mixture of shock and numbness.

Could it be that Zheng Zhouzhou said something to Ji Heyuan?

Jiang Jiang began to test Ji Heyuan, “Xiao Yuan, did you sleep well last night?”

Ji Xu’an was driving, and after hearing Jiang Jiang’s words, she also looked at Ji Heyuan through the rearview mirror.

Jiang Jiang asked casually, but Ji Heyuan reacted as if a secret had been exposed, her whole demeanor bristling. “Wh-what? I definitely slept very well last night!”

That meant she didn’t sleep well.

Could it be that after seeing He Xinyao’s miserable state last night, she had a nightmare?

“I slept soundly last night, I didn’t dream at all!” Ji Heyuan avoided Ji Xu’an’s gaze, afraid her sister would see through her little thoughts.

God only knows how much Ji Heyuan was questioning her entire existence at that moment.

She’d dreamt all night. Initially, it was just a jumble of images, but then, inexplicably, Zheng Zhouzhou appeared in Ji Heyuan’s dream.

The Zheng Zhouzhou in the dream looked at her with red, accusing eyes, demanding to know why she was changing her affections.

Ji Heyuan found this strange. When had she changed her affections? While her feelings for Zheng Zhouzhou weren’t as strong as before, it was only because of Zheng Zhouzhou’s actions that had disappointed her.

This was her and Zheng Zhouzhou’s business from beginning to end, what did it have to do with other people?

Ji Heyuan reasoned this, and asked as much, but Zheng Zhouzhou pointed at her and sharply demanded, “Then what’s the relationship between you and that woman behind you? Why are you protecting her like this?”

Where did the woman behind me come from?

Ji Heyuan turned her head, puzzled, only to be met with a pair of shockingly familiar eyes that left her speechless.

Ji Heyuan widened her eyes in horror.

“Xie Jiang Jiang?!”

The Xie Jiang Jiang in the dream felt strangely off. Though her face was the same, Ji Heyuan felt that her demeanor and movements were unlike the Xie Jiang Jiang she knew.

It wasn’t until the figure in the dream grabbed her sleeve and called her “A-Yuan” in an intimate tone that Ji Heyuan became even more suspicious that this wasn’t Xie Jiang Jiang at all.

I must be bewitched. When has Xie Jiang Jiang ever used such a tone to talk to me?

But Ji Heyuan still couldn’t figure it out. How could she dream of a girl who looked exactly like Xie Jiang Jiang, and Zheng Zhouzhou was so sure that she liked this person.

Even in the dream, Ji Heyuan tried her best to clear her relationship with that girl, but she couldn’t explain it at all. On one side, Zheng Zhouzhou’s angry and sad accusations were in her ears, and on the other side, it was the voice of the replica Xie Jiang Jiang calling her A-Yuan. Ji Heyuan felt that her head was about to explode.

She was finally awakened by this nightmare-like scene, and even when she suddenly sat up from the bed, Ji Heyuan was still chanting “Stop shouting, stop shouting” in her mouth.

It took her a long time to completely come back to her senses, but even so, Ji Heyuan still didn’t dare to look at Ji Xu’an and Jiang Jiang’s eyes, for fear of revealing her thoughts.

She doubted anyone would believe her; it was truly too unbelievable.

Ji Heyuan even wanted to post on the emotional forum.

What is it like to dream that you and your sister-in-law become a couple?

It was also because of that magical dream last night that Ji Heyuan not only didn’t dare to face Jiang Jiang, but even didn’t plan to reply to Zheng Zhouzhou’s message.

It must be because Zheng Zhouzhou constantly mentioned Jiang Jiang, making Ji Heyuan subconsciously perceive a negative relationship between them, leading to such a bizarre dream.

Anyway, it’s definitely not because I have any thoughts about Xie Jiang Jiang!

Ji Heyuan muttered in her heart, but she still had to show a stiff smile on her face. She forcibly changed the subject and said, “How did you two sleep last night?”

Jiang Jiang stopped talking immediately. She glanced at Ji Xu’an, and the hands on her legs shrunk unconsciously, gently grasping the hem of her clothes.

Ji Xu’an caught a glimpse of this scene with her peripheral vision, and the fingertips on the steering wheel moved. She pursed her lips and didn’t speak.

The three of them rode in silence for the rest of the journey. It wasn’t until the car stopped that Ji Heyuan jolted awake and quickly got out of the car.

“Well.” Ji Heyuan rubbed her palms, “Sister, anyway, you’re not in a hurry to go to work, why don’t you send Xie Jiang Jiang to the classroom?”

She really didn’t have the courage to help Jiang Jiang now. Ji Heyuan needed enough time to forget that dream.

Fortunately, Ji Xu’an didn’t ask much. She put her arm around Jiang Jiang’s shoulder, and almost half-hugged the person into the classroom.

Jiang Jiang relaxed against Ji Xu’an. Their hands were clasped tightly, their body temperatures mingling, their heartbeats syncing.

Jiang Jiang’s classmates had seen Ji Heyuan, but it was the first time they had seen Ji Xu’an. The mature elite temperament on Ji Xu’an made everyone a little afraid to talk to her, but everyone’s eyes more or less stayed on her for a while.

After Ji Xu’an sent Jiang Jiang to the classroom, she didn’t leave immediately, but took her cup to help her get water.

When she stood in front of the water dispenser, someone suddenly called her.

“Xu’an.”

Ji Xu’an recognized the voice of the person who came. She turned her head and nodded to Wen Xueyun, “Good morning.”

Wen Xueyun looked at the familiar thermos cup in her hand, and the smile on her lips couldn’t help but fade a little, “Sending your girlfriend to class?”

“Yeah.” Ji Xu’an took half a cup of hot water, and added some cold water to it, the temperature was just right.

Wen Xueyun couldn’t believe Ji Xu’an would do such thoughtful things for others. The Ji Xu’an she knew was always cold and distant. She spoke to people, but had no close friends, maintaining a distance from everyone.

Wen Xueyun believed that if it wasn’t because Ji Heyuan and Jiang Jiang both applied to S University, and she happened to work at S University, Ji Xu’an might not have remembered her at all.

Now, she had given up on Ji Xu’an, but watching someone get what she had dreamed of, Wen Xueyun still felt a bit bitter in her heart.

She quietly watched this scene. The Ji Xu’an in front of her seemed to be no different from the Ji Xu’an in her memory, still so cold and distant, but Wen Xueyun knew that something was different.

When Ji Xu’an thought of Jiang Jiang, her eyes were much gentler than before.

She sighed sincerely, “Xu’an, though I still have some regrets, I’m happy to see you’ve found someone you truly love.”

Ji Xu’an knew what Wen Xueyun’s regrets were, but she didn’t ask much. She was more interested in the second half of Wen Xueyun’s sentence.

“Do you think I… like Jiang Jiang very much?” Ji Xu’an hesitated.

Wen Xueyun frowned in confusion, “Hmm?”

What kind of question is this?

Could it be that Ji Xu’an didn’t actually like Jiang Jiang?

Wen Xueyun didn’t believe it was an act. Ji Xu’an’s kindness towards Jiang Jiang was genuine.

“How can outsiders truly understand matters of the heart? You already have the answer, haven’t you?” Wen Xueyun never expected she’d one day help the person she likes and love rival get together.

Ji Xu’an’s expression was very serious, and she seemed to be really humbly asking Wen Xueyun, “Do you think my liking for Jiang Jiang is the liking for a future partner?”

Wen Xueyun’s mood was particularly complicated, it was a feeling of bitterness mixed with a bit of amusement, “If you don’t like her, with your personality, would you do such caring things?”

She raised her chin, signaling Ji Xu’an to look at the thermos cup in her own hand.

Ji Xu’an tightened the fingers around the thermos cup, her voice was very light, not knowing whether she was replying to Wen Xueyun, or simply talking to herself.

“Is that so?”

While she was still confused and uncertain, others had already recognized her feelings for Jiang Jiang before she herself did?

Wen Xueyun sighed, she asked Ji Xu’an, “Xiao Yuan is also taking classes next door, did you get her water?”

Ji Xu’an was stunned.

Wen Xueyun spread out her hand, “See, Xiao Yuan is your own sister, yet you’re not so meticulous to her.”

Ji Xu’an was thoughtful, she nodded slightly to Wen Xueyun, and said sincerely, “Thank you, I understand, you take your time to get water, I’ll go first.”

Wen Xueyun paused, “I’ll go with you.”

She had already gotten the water just now, Ji Xu’an didn’t see it at all.

She and Ji Xu’an walked towards the classroom one after the other. Just as they reached the door, the two saw that there was another person next to Jiang Jiang at some point.

Because they were sitting in the first row, the conversation between the two was also clearly audible.

The young girl supported her chin and asked Jiang Jiang curiously, “Who was the person who sent you here just now? Is it your sister?”

Jiang Jiang didn’t find Ji Xu’an at the door, she curved her lips and showed a shy smile.

“No, she’s my fiancee.”
